The multiplier is exciting, but the base game still runs the show

Lightning Roulette looks flashy because of the boosted straight-up payouts, but under that production, it’s still roulette. Simple truth. You can’t force a lightning number to appear, and you definitely can’t predict which one gets tagged on the next spin.

So what can you actually control? Your stake size, your spread, and your stop-loss. That’s where smart play lives. Most players find this less exciting than talking about 500x hits, but it matters more than people expect.

Stop chasing every big number and tighten your betting spread

If you’re betting ten or more straight-up numbers every round just to “cover” more lightning possibilities, you’re usually watering down the value of a hit. Better to stay selective.

  • Pick 3 to 5 straight-up numbers. Small coverage keeps your cost sane.
  • Add one outside bet if you want a little cushion. Red/black or even/odd won’t catch lightning, but they can slow the bankroll bleed when the singles miss.
  • Skip messy systems.

What kind of bankroll actually makes sense here?

Not a heroic one. Just a realistic one.

A good rule is to keep each round to around 1% to 2% of your session bankroll. If you bring ₱2,000, don’t play like you brought ₱10,000. Sounds obvious, right? Yet this is where players fall apart after two dead spins and one near miss.

One habit that helps more than players expect

Set a win ceiling before you start. Say 30% up, then leave. Lightning Roulette creates that dangerous feeling that one more spin could be the 500x spin. It could. But one more spin also gives back half your profit in three minutes.
